The Summer I Turned Pretty Season 3 Episode 8 Release Date
The Summer I Turned Pretty season three, episode eight, will be available to stream on Prime Video on August 27, 2025.
New episodes of The Summer I Turned Pretty season three premiere on Prime Video each Wednesday through September 17, 2025.
The Summer I Turned Pretty Season 3 Episode 8 – How to Watch
The Summer I Turned Pretty season three, episode eight, lands at Midnight Pacific Time (PT)/3 am Eastern Time (ET) on Prime Video and will be available to stream on Prime Video.
You will need a Prime Video subscription to watch The Summer I Turned Pretty season three. Prime Video costs $14.99 per month or $139 annually when included with an Amazon Prime membership, or you can subscribe to the streaming service alone for $8.99 per month.

A new report has confirmed that former AEW World Champion Swerve Strickland is currently working with a legitimate torn meniscus. The injury was acknowledged on this week's episode of AEW Dynamite. According to a new report from Sean Ross Sapp of Fightful Select, the on-screen injury announcement is based on a real-life issue that Strickland has been dealing with for years. The news comes as Strickland is preparing for a championship match at the upcoming Forbidden Door pay-per-view. The Swerve Strickland Injury On the August 13 episode of AEW Dynamite, it was mentioned on commentary that AEW doctors had seen Swerve Strickland for a knee injury. The Fightful report has now confirmed that Strickland is working with a torn meniscus. The report also notes that this is not a new injury. He has reportedly had a tear in his meniscus since his time training at the WWE Performance Center in 2019. At that time, he rested the injury for four weeks and was able to return to television. It now appears that the grueling in-ring style of the high-flyer has aggravated the old injury. AEW sources also indicated that medical staff from the Jacksonville Jaguars, the NFL team also owned by AEW's Tony Khan, are helping him with his recovery. The report states that there is a possibility he could require surgery and time off in the near future. BOGOTA, COLOMBIA - NOVEMBER 16: A general view of the AAA Mexican Lucha Libre friday night show at the Movistar Arena during an AAA World Wide Wrestling match on November 16, 2018 in Bogota, Colombia.A History of "The Realest" Swerve Strickland has been one of AEW's biggest breakout stars of the past two years. After a successful run in WWE NXT as the leader of the Hit Row faction, he was released and eventually signed with AEW. His career reached a new level when he formed the Mogul Embassy faction. His intense, personal, and bloody feud with "Hangman" Adam Page was one of the most acclaimed rivalries of 2023. This momentum propelled him to the main event, and at the Dynasty pay-per-view in April 2024, he defeated Samoa Joe to win the AEW World Championship, becoming the first African American man to hold the title. 'Lurker' hits theaters Aug. 22. How far would you go for a front-row seat to fame? That's the question at heart of Lurker, a new film from The Bear writer Alex Russell. In the movie, which hits theaters Aug. 22, Théodore Pellerin plays Matthew, whose chance encounter with rising musician Oliver (Archie Madekwe) leads to him joining the performer's inner circle. But it's not easy being on the inside, and the more desperate Matthew becomes to stay close to Oliver, the less Oliver wants him around — leading Matthew to make a series of disturbing choices in which he succeeds at flipping his dynamic with Oliver on its head. Lurker is not the first to give us insight into the joys — and inherent dangers — of obsession. The film, which currently has a 96% score on Rotten Tomatoes, fits firmly into a growing subgenre of movies that are about getting as close as possible to the object of one's unrelenting obsession. What she thought was a precious moment between her husband and their dog turned out to be a moment of panic when the off-leash canine bolted. Han Mays and his wife Sophia took their rescue dog, Swanson, to the Imperial Sand Dunes in Southern California for an adventure day. He told Newsweek via TikTok that the day's plan would be to walk him around and run with him on the leash. "We were able to find an area with absolutely nobody around for miles, and so I thought, 'Why not let him really let loose for once in an area where there's no harm nor foul to be done?'" he said. But after the initial five seconds of being off-leash and staring at Han, Swanson took his chance. Han's heart quickened when his idea of a perfect scenario got derailed. Han imagined they'd chase each other and play a game of fetch, but instead, Swanson ran as fast as he could through the desert dunes, leaving his owners in the dust. Screenshot from an August 13 TikTok video of an owner chasing his dog through the sand dunes after letting the canine off leash. Screenshot from an August 13 TikTok video of an owner chasing his dog through the sand dunes after letting the canine off leash. @hanmays/TikTok Meanwhile, Han's wife started filming the chase between the dog as she thought they were playing. She wanted to film the moment with the beautiful scenery, oblivious to the reality, which was shared to the TikTok account @hanmays last week. But soon enough, Han revealed the truth—the dog almost ran away. Han knew Swanson would be quicker than him in the sand, but as a half American bulldog, his stamina wouldn't last. He expected he would catch Swanson rather quickly. He said the video stopped before capturing Swanson stopping about three feet beyond the edge of the dune because he tired out. Once Sophia realized, she laughed. She thought it was hilarious because she first advised him against taking off the leash. But now that he got Swanson back and learned his lesson about letting the dog off-leash, they went back and watched the video about 50 times, cracking up at the mistake.
